Research Interests:

  • Physiological plasticity of fishes to environmental change
  • Culture of economically important fish species
  • Conservation aquaculture of imperiled or non-game fishes
  • Physiological ecology of primitive fishes
  • Osmo- and ionoregulation in fishes
  • Calcium regulation in fishes

Teaching Areas:

  • Physiology of fishes
  • Principles of fish culture
